Нужно сделать алгоритм(блок-схему) для программы:const k = 14; var n: array[1..k]
Необходимо сделать алгоритм(блок-схему) для программки:
const
k = 14;
var
n: array[1..k] of integer;
sum, i, kpol: integer;
p: real;
begin
randomize;
kpol := 0;
sum := 0;
p := 1;
for i := 1 to k do
begin
n[i] := random(23) - 6;
write(n[i]:4);
if (i mod 2 = 0) and (n[i] gt; 0) then
inc(kpol);
if n[i] lt; 0 then
sum := sum + n[i];
if (i mod 3 = 0) and (n[i] gt; 0) then
p := p * n[i];
end;
writeln;
writeln('Количество положительных частей, стоящих на чётных местах: ', kpol);
writeln('Сумма частей, имеющих отрицательные значения: ', sum);
writeln('Творенье положительных частей массива, стоящих на местах, номера которых кратны трём: ', p);
end.
-
Вопросы ответы
Статьи
Информатика
Статьи
Математика.
Физика.
Математика.
Разные вопросы.
Разные вопросы.
Математика.
Разные вопросы.
Математика.
Физика.
Геометрия.